INTRODUCTION: Native hip dislocations are defined as traumatic dislocations of the hip, typically high-energy and associated with polytrauma. The majority of these injuries occur following motor vehicle accidents (MVAs). Due to the inherent stability of the hip joint, a significant force is required to cause dislocation. It is critical that such injuries are managed and reduced in a timely manner. We evaluated the current practice in a major trauma centre (MTC) in Cardiff and gathered information from emergency departments (EDs) in Wales and MTCs around the United Kingdom (UK). METHODS: We did an evaluation of the current practice with a retrospective audit of all traumatic native hip dislocations presenting to the MTC at Cardiff from August 2018 to February 2021. Data was obtained from Trauma Audit and Research Network (TARN), medical records, radiology and theatre management systems. An online survey was developed and disseminated to EDs in Wales and MTCs across the UK. RESULTS: There were 15 traumatic hip dislocation cases over the period evaluated. Sixty percent of cases were due to MVA. Eighty-six percent of patients had an associated fracture, with one Pipkin type IV fracture dislocation. The mean time to reduction from injury was 532 minutes (240-804 minutes), with 28.6% reduced within 6 hours and 71.4% reduced within 12 hours. Two patients had reduction performed in the ED (mean time to reduction, 275 minutes). There was one occurrence of avascular necrosis (AVN) and one of chondrolysis at the follow-up. The response rate to the survey was 80% and 83% in Wales and MTCs nationally, respectively. The majority (82%) of departments did not have an established pathway in place for managing traumatic native hip dislocations with a preference for reduction in the operating theatre. CONCLUSION: Native hip dislocations are rare, high-energy injuries associated with significant morbidity. The available evidence suggests time to reduction is imperative in reducing the risk of future complications. The establishment of a pathway to guide management and having a mechanism to perform reductions in the ED may produce significant reductions in this time, impacting outcomes.

OBJECTIVE: This is a single-surgeon series that prospectively evaluates the results of sacroiliac joint (SIJ) fusion for patients with SIJ dysfunction using hydroxyapatite-coated screws (HACSs) compared with titanium triangular dowels (TTDs). METHODS: A total of 113 patients underwent SIJ fusion surgery between 2013 and 2018 at the University Hospital Llandough to treat symptomatic SIJ dysfunction not responding to nonoperative measures. Of the 113 patients, 40 were treated with HACSs and 73 with TTDs. Patient-reported outcomes measures (PROMs) were collected preoperatively and at 12 months postoperatively, including the 36-item short-form health survey, Oswestry disability index, EuroQol-5D-5L, and Majeed pelvic score. Patients with ongoing symptoms were followed up beyond the study period. RESULTS: Of the 113 patients, 33 completed follow-up in the HACS group compared with 61 in the TTD group. Both groups had comparable preoperative PROMs; however, the postoperative PROMs were significantly better in the TTD group. Additionally, 21 patients (63%) in the HACS group had radiological evidence of screw lysis compared with 5 patients (9%) in the TTD group. A subgroup analysis revealed less significant improvement in PROMs for patients with screw lysis compared with those without. Four patients were offered further revision surgery. CONCLUSIONS: Minimally invasive SIJ fusion has been shown to have good clinical outcomes for select patients. However, our experience shows that HACSs are associated with a high rate of screw lysis and poorer patient outcomes compared with TTDs. Therefore, we recommend the use of TTDs instead of HACSs for SIJ fusion surgery.

Aims: The primary aim of this study was to report the radiological outcomes of patients with a dorsally displaced distal radius fracture who were randomized to a moulded cast or surgical fixation with wires following manipulation and closed reduction of their fracture. The secondary aim was to correlate radiological outcomes with patient-reported outcome measures (PROMs) in the year following injury. Methods: Participants were recruited as part of DRAFFT2, a UK multicentre clinical trial. Participants were aged 16 years or over with a dorsally displaced distal radius fracture, and were eligible for the trial if they needed a manipulation of their fracture, as recommended by their treating surgeon. Participants were randomly allocated on a 1:1 ratio to moulded cast or Kirschner wires after manipulation of the fracture in the operating theatre. Standard posteroanterior and lateral radiographs were performed in the radiology department of participating centres at the time of the patient's initial assessment in the emergency department and six weeks postoperatively. Intraoperative fluoroscopic images taken at the time of fracture reduction were also assessed. Results: Patients treated with surgical fixation with wires had less dorsal angulation of the radius versus those treated in a moulded cast at six weeks after manipulation of the fracture; the mean difference of -4.13° was statistically significant (95% confidence interval 5.82 to -2.45). There was no evidence of a difference in radial shortening. However, there was no correlation between these radiological measurements and PROMs at any timepoint in the 12 months post-injury. Conclusion: For patients with a dorsally displaced distal radius fracture treated with a closed manipulation, surgical fixation with wires leads to less dorsal angulation on radiographs at six weeks compared with patients treated in a moulded plaster cast alone. However, the difference in dorsal angulation was small and did not correlate with patient-reported pain and function.

Aim The purpose of this all Wales national audit was to compare compliance against British Orthopedic Association Standards for Trauma (BOAST) guidelines on the management of ankle fractures. Methods A multi-center prospective audit of the management of adult ankle fractures was conducted between February 2, 2020, and February 17, 2020, via the Welsh Orthopedic Research Collaborative (WORC). Regional leads were recruited in nine NHS hospitals across six university health boards, and recruited collaborators in their respective hospitals. Questionnaires for the data collection on both surgical and conservative management were made available via a password-protected website (walesortho.co.uk). We defined early weight-bearing (EWB) as unrestricted weight-bearing on the affected leg within three weeks of injury or surgery and delayed weight-bearing (DWB) as unrestricted weight-bearing after three weeks of injury or surgery. Results A total of 28 collaborators contributed data for 238 ankle fractures. Poor documentation at the time of injury was noted. Less than 50% of patients with posterior malleolus fracture had a CT scan for further evaluation. Eighty-four percent of the non-operatively treated patients did not have a weight-bearing X-ray (WBXR). Patients who had a WBXR were more likely to be allowed EWB but this was not statistically significant. EWB was allowed in 59.43% and 10% of the non-operatively and operatively treated patients, respectively. DWB was higher in patients who had fixation of the posterior malleolus or syndesmosis. Conclusion There is poor compliance with BOAST guidelines on the management of ankle fractures across Wales. We need to improve documentation and also consider performing a CT scan when the posterior malleolus is fractured. A weight-bearing X-ray should be performed more often to ascertain the stability of an ankle fracture, and those that are deemed stable should be treated with early weight-bearing. The guidelines need to be clearer regarding weight-bearing after fixation especially when posterior malleolus and/or syndesmosis are fixed.

INTRODUCTION: Recruitment of patients to participate in randomized control trials (RCT) is a challenging task, especially for trauma trials in which the identification and recruitment are time-limited. Multiple strategies have been tried to improve the participation of doctors and the recruitment of patients. The aim was to study the effect of a trainee principal investigator (TPI) on the efficacy of recruitment for a multicenter hip fracture RCT. METHODS: A retrospective study comparing the number of junior doctors participating in the WHiTE 8 COPAL RCT and patients recruited before and after the introduction of formal TPI role at a major trauma center in the UK. Data was collected for nine months "before" (Nov 2018-July 2019) and six months "after" (Sept 2019-Feb 2020) the role of TPI was assigned. RESULTS: From November 2018 to February 2020, a total of 292 patients were eligible for recruitment into this trial, out of which 196 (67.12 %) were successfully recruited. Excluding the research team, there were seven junior doctors actively recruiting in the "before period" in comparison with 10 in the "after period." Significantly more patients were recruited by junior doctors after a TPI was assigned. Overall, more percentage of eligible patients were recruited into the trial after a TPI was assigned, and this was statistically significant. CONCLUSION: The allocation of a formal TPI significantly improved the recruitment of patients in a national RCT. TPI can work alongside the principal investigator and research team to be a valuable link person coordinating and engaging local trainees to take part in trials.

The coronavirus disease 2019 (COVID-19) pandemic has necessitated many rapid changes in the provision and delivery of health care in hospital. This study aimed to explore the patient experience of inpatient care during COVID-19 pandemic. An electronic questionnaire was designed and distributed to inpatients treated at a large University Health Board over a 6-week period. It focused on hospital inpatients' experience of being cared for by health care professionals wearing personal protective equipment (PPE), explored communication, and patients' perceptions of the quality of care. A total of 704 patients completed the survey. Results demonstrated that patients believe PPE is important to protect the health of both patients and staff and does not negatively impact on their care. In spite of routine use of PPE, patients were still able to identify and communicate with staff. Although visiting restrictions were enforced to limit disease transmission, patients maintained contact with their relatives by using various electronic forms of communication. Overall, patients rated the quality of care they received at 9/10. This single-center study demonstrates a positive patient experience of care at an unprecedented time.

OBJECTIVE: This is a single-surgeon series to prospectively evaluate the clinical and radiologic results of sacroiliac joint (SIJ) stabilization using hydroxyapatite (HA)-coated, fully threaded screws in patients with SIJ dysfunction. METHODS: A total number of 40 patients underwent percutaneous SIJ stabilization using HA-coated screws between 2013 and 2015 at the University Hospital of LLandough with an age range of 33-84 years. Patients were followed up closely, and outcome scores were collected preoperative and 12 months after surgery. Preoperative and postoperative outcomes were evaluated using patient-reported outcome measures (PROMs), Short Form-36, Oswestry Disability Index, EuroQol-5D-5L, and Majeed Pelvic Scores. RESULTS: Thirty-three patients (8 male and 32 female) out of the 40 patients completed follow-up. There was an overall improvement in all PROMs; however, only mental component of SF-36, Oswestry Disability Index, Majeed Pelvic Scores, and EuroQol-5D-5L were statistically significant. Twenty-one patients (63%) had lysis around the screw, and a subgroup analysis showed that improvement in PROMs was significantly less in patients with lysis around the screw. Four patients with lysis around the screw were offered revision due to ongoing pain. Revision was successful in only 1 patient. CONCLUSIONS: Percutaneous SIJ fixation procedure has been shown to have good clinical outcomes, but the use of HA-coated fully threaded screws in this procedure is not recommended on the basis of patient-reported outcome measures and radiologic findings in this prospective study.

AIMS: The COVID-19 pandemic has had a significant impact on the provision of orthopaedic care across the UK. During the pandemic orthopaedic specialist registrars were redeployed to "frontline" specialties occupying non-surgical roles. The impact of the COVID-19 pandemic on orthopaedic training in the UK is unknown. This paper sought to examine the role of orthopaedic trainees during the COVID-19 and the impact of COVID-19 pandemic on postgraduate orthopaedic education. METHODS: A 42-point questionnaire was designed, validated, and disseminated via e-mail and an instant-messaging platform. RESULTS: A total of 101 orthopaedic trainees, representing the four nations (Wales, England, Scotland, and Northern Ireland), completed the questionnaire. Overall, 23.1% (23/101) of trainees were redeployed to non-surgical roles. Of these, 73% (17/23) were redeployed to intensive treatment units (ITUs), 13% (3/23) to A/E, and 13%(3/23%) to general medicine. Of the trainees redeployed to ITU 100%, (17/17) received formal induction. Non-deployed or returning trainees had a significant reduction in sessions. In total, 42.9% (42/101) % of trainees were not timetabled into fracture clinic, 53% (53/101) of trainees had one allocated theatre list per week, and 63.8%(64/101) of trainees did not feel they obtained enough experience in the attached subspecialty and preferred repeating this. Overall, 93% (93/101) of respondents attended at least one weekly online webinar, with 79% (79/101) of trainees rating these as useful or very useful, while 95% (95/101) trainees attended online deanery teaching which was rated as more useful than online webinars (p = 0.005). CONCLUSION: Orthopaedic specialist trainees occupied an important role during the COVID-19 pandemic. COVID-19 has had a significant impact on orthopaedic training. It is imperative this is properly understood to ensure orthopaedic specialist trainees achieve competencies set out in the training curriculum.Cite this article: Bone Joint Open 2020;1-11:676-682.

AIMS: The adequate provision of personal protective equipment (PPE) for healthcare workers has come under considerable scrutiny during the COVID-19 pandemic. This study aimed to evaluate staff awareness of PPE guidance, perceptions of PPE measures, and concerns regarding PPE use while caring for COVID-19 patients. In addition, responses of doctors, nurses, and other healthcare professionals (OHCPs) were compared. METHODS: The inclusion criteria were all staff working in clinical areas of the hospital. Staff were invited to take part using a link to an online questionnaire advertised by email, posters displayed in clinical areas, and social media. Questions grouped into the three key themes - staff awareness, perceptions, and concerns - were answered using a five-point Likert scale. The Kruskal-Wallis test was used to compare results across all three groups of staff. RESULTS: Overall, 315 staff took part in our study. There was a high awareness of PPE guidance at 84.4%, but only 52.4% of staff reported adequate PPE provision. 67.9% were still keen to come to work, despite very high levels of anxiety relating to contracting COVID-19 despite wearing PPE. Doctors had significantly higher ratings for questions relating to PPE awareness compared to other staff groups, while nursing staff and OHCPs had significantly higher levels of anxiety compared to doctors in relation to PPE and contracting COVID-19 (p < 0.05 using a Kruskal-Wallis test). CONCLUSION: We believe four recommendations are key to improve PPE measures and decrease anxiety: 1) nominated ward/department PPE champions; 2) anonymized reporting for PPE concerns; 3) formal PPE education sessions; and 4) drop-in counselling sessions for staff. We hope the insight and recommendations from this study can improve the PPE situation and maintain the health and wellbeing of the clinical work force, in order to care for COVID-19 patients safely and effectively.

AIMS: COVID-19 has changed the practice of orthopaedics across the globe. The medical workforce has dealt with this outbreak with varying strategies and adaptations, which are relevant to its field and to the region. As one of the 'hotspots' in the UK , the surgical branch of trauma and orthopaedics need strategies to adapt to the ever-changing landscape of COVID-19. METHODS: Adapting to the crisis locally involved five operational elements: 1) triaging and workflow of orthopaedic patients; 2) operation theatre feasibility and functioning; 3) conservation of human resources and management of workforce in the department; 4) speciality training and progression; and 5) developing an exit strategy to resume elective work. Two hospitals under our trust were redesignated based on the treatment of COVID-19 patients. Registrar/consultant led telehealth reviews were carried out for early postoperative patients. Workflows for the management of outpatient care and inpatient care were created. We looked into the development of a dedicated operating space to perform the emergency orthopaedic surgeries without symptoms of COVID-19. Between March 23 and April 23, 2020, we have surgically treated 133 patients across both our hospitals in our trust. This mainly included hip fractures and fractures/infection affecting the hand. CONCLUSION: The COVID-19 pandemic is not the first disease outbreak affecting the UK, nor will it be the last. The current crisis has necessitated rapid development of new hospital guidelines and early adaptive strategies in our services. Protocols and directives need to be formalized keeping in mind that COVID-19 will have a long and protracted course until a definitive cure is discovered.

INTRODUCTION: We hypothesised that the use of a polyaxial locking plate design offers the same clinical benefits as a monoaxial locking plate system following distal femoral osteoporotic/periprosthetic fracture fixation. METHOD: A multicentre prospective randomised pilot trial was conducted. Inclusion criteria were patients over 60 years with a displaced osteoporotic or periprosthetic distal femoral fracture. Details documented included time to union, complications, reinterventions and functional outcomes according to the Oxford knee score and EuroQol EQ-5D. Analysis of factors influencing an early fracture healing response was performed between those with clear features of radiological callus formation at three months. Statistical analysis was performed using a logistic regression model with multiple covariates assessed for each plate system (1:1 ratio) over a follow-up period of one year. RESULTS: Forty patients (34 females) with a mean age of 77 (60-99) were recruited. Four patients deceased within the first six months. Twenty-five patients united by the six month follow-up. Six more patients progressed to union between six and nine months. Five patients developed non-union (two patients had implant failure; one in each group) and all underwent revision surgery. Malunion was evident in two cases, one with 15° of valgus (monoaxial plate), and one with 12° of recurvatum (polyaxial plate). Between the two plate systems, statistical analysis revealed no significant differences in most of the recorded parameters. Radiological features of early bone healing were present when the surgical approach was smaller (p = 0.015), and when a greater working length of the bridging plate was present (p = 0.016). CONCLUSION: Both plate systems demonstrated good union rates and limited implant related complications. Good reduction, mechanically sound construct and respect of the local fracture biology was more important than the particular plate design characteristics.

INTRODUCTION: Shoulder dislocations are common. It is known that incongruent shoulder should be promptly reduced. However, when associated with fracture of the proximal humerus, there is a clinical dilemma if reduction under sedation is a safe option. We wanted to establish when it is safe to attempt reduction of a shoulder fracture dislocation under sedation in emergency room. METHODS: This is a retrospective cohort study assessing consecutive patients presenting with a dislocation of a gleno-humeral joint with an associated fracture of the humerus between 2007 and 2015. The radiographs and patients' records were examined. The number of fragments according to Neer's criteria and size of fragments were recorded. RESULTS: We identified 102 patients who presented with 104 cases of fracture dislocation of shoulder joint. 10 of the dislocations were posterior, remainder were anterior. All posterior dislocations were reduced under general anaesthesia. Sixty-two anterior fracture dislocations had attempted reduction under sedation in emergency department. Eight of those were unsuccessful, and patient required general anaesthetic for further management. In five of those cases, significant displacement of humeral head in relation to the shaft after attempted reduction. CONCLUSION: We propose pragmatic approach to the initial treatment of fracture dislocations of shoulder. In type I injury, where there is an anterior dislocation with greater tuberosity fracture, one should attempt a reduction under sedation; 94% of attempted reductions under sedation were successful and no fracture propagation occurred. In case of a type II injury, when the fracture is involving a surgical neck of the humerus with or without greater tuberosities fracture, our experience suggests that no attempt of reduction is undertaken under sedation and patient has general anaesthetic. Posterior dislocation with any fracture remains an unsolved problem, but in our series no attempt of reduction under sedation was made.

PURPOSE: The Majeed scoring system is a disease-specific outcome measure that was originally designed to assess pelvic injuries. The aim of this study was to determine the psychometric properties of the Majeed scoring system for chronic sacroiliac joint pain. METHODS: Internal consistency, content validity, criterion validity, construct validity and responsiveness to change was assessed prospectively for the Majeed scoring system in a cohort of 60 patients diagnosed with sacroiliac joint pain. This diagnosis was confirmed with CT-guided sacroiliac joint anaesthetic block. RESULTS: The overall Majeed score showed acceptable internal consistency (Cronbach alpha = 0.63). Similarly, it showed acceptable floor (0 %) and ceiling (0 %) effects. On the other hand, the domains of pain, work, sitting and sexual intercourse had high (>30 %) floor effects. Significant correlation with the physical component of the Short Form-36 (p = 0.005) and Oswestry disability index (p ≤ 0.001) was found indicating acceptable criterion validity. The overall Majeed score showed acceptable construct validity with all five developed hypotheses showing significance (p ≤ 0.05). The overall Majeed score showed acceptable responsiveness to change with a large (≥0.80) effect size and standardized response mean. CONCLUSION: Overall the Majeed scoring system demonstrated acceptable psychometric properties for outcome assessment in chronic sacroiliac joint pain. Thus, its use in this condition is adequate. However, some domains demonstrated suboptimal performance indicating that improvement might be achieved with the development of an outcome measure specific for sacroiliac joint dysfunction and degeneration.

BACKGROUND: Conventional management protocols for distal humeral extra-articular fractures (e.g. conservative, double columnar plating) are often associated with complications. We aimed to describe our experience of using the Synthes™ 3.5-mm extra-articular distal humeral locking compression plate for treatment of extra-articular distal humeral fractures. METHODS: We prospectively studied 23 consecutive patients who underwent fixation, in a tertiary trauma centre, over 2 years. Data, including patient demographics, duration of follow-up, patient satisfaction, visual analogue score (VAS), Oxford Elbow Score, and final outcome on discharge, were collected and analyzed. RESULTS: Of the 23 patients (12 males, 11 females; mean age 47.5 years; range 18 years to 89 years), all fractures united radiologically and clinically after the index procedure, with a mean time to fracture union of 15.7 weeks (range 9 weeks to 34 weeks) and a mean time to discharge of 17.8 weeks (range 13 weeks to 34 weeks). Oxford Elbow Score was 36.5 (range 11 to 48) at 4.6 months postoperatively; at 20 months follow-up, it was 40 (range 14 to 48) and the VAS was 8.5 (range 5 to 10). One patient had radial nerve neuropraxia pre-operatively, and one postoperatively, and both recovered uneventfully 3 months postoperatively. Neither superficial, nor deep infections were observed in this cohort. CONCLUSIONS: The present study reports satisfactory outcome with the usage of the Synthes plate for extra-articular fracture management. It has become the technique of choice in our centre because it provides excellent results.

OBJECTIVE: The aim of the study was to evaluate inter-observer reliability and intra-observer reproducibility between the three-column classification and Schatzker classification systems using 2D and 3D CT models. MATERIALS AND METHODS: Fifty-two consecutive patients with tibial plateau fractures were evaluated by five orthopaedic surgeons. All patients were classified into Schatzker and three-column classification systems using x-rays and 2D and 3D CT images. The inter-observer reliability was evaluated in the first round and the intra-observer reliability was determined during the second round 2 weeks later. RESULTS: The average intra-observer reproducibility for the three-column classification was from substantial to excellent in all sub classifications, as compared with Schatzker classification. The inter-observer kappa values increased from substantial to excellent in three-column classification and to moderate in Schatzker classification The average values for three-column classification for all the categories are as follows: (I-III) k2D = 0.718, 95% CI 0.554-0.864, p < 0.0001 and average 3D = 0.874, 95% CI 0.754-0.890, p < 0.0001. For Schatzker classification system, the average values for all six categories are as follows: (I-VI) k2D = 0.536, 95% CI 0.365-0.685, p < 0.0001 and average k3D = 0.552 95% CI 0.405-0.700, p < 0.0001. The values are statistically significant. CONCLUSION: Statistically significant inter-observer values in both rounds were noted with the three-column classification, making it statistically an excellent agreement. The intra-observer reproducibility for the three-column classification improved as compared with the Schatzker classification. The three-column classification seems to be an effective way to characterise and classify fractures of tibial plateau.

INTRODUCTION: Despite being the most common fracture around the elbow, the management of Mason type 1 radial head fractures lacks a clear protocol in literature. The aims of this study were to assess our practice of managing this injury and to create guidance for the management of these fractures based on literature review. METHODS: We designed a survey investigating the practice of orthopaedic surgeons in the management of Mason type 1 fracture. The literature review was carried out looking for the best practice guidelines. RESULTS: Forty-nine surgeons (out of 56) responded, and mean duration of immobilisation was 11.69 days with the collar and cuff sling as the preferred method. 65.3% offered physiotherapy service to their patients. 20.4% recommended plain radiographic imaging follow-up. Mean duration of follow-up was 43.9 days. Decision to discharge the patient was mostly (77.6%) dependent on clinical improvement at time of last examination. 4.1% of treatment decisions were evidence based. CONCLUSION: We observed a wide variation in the management of this common injury. Based on the current literature, the best protocol for the management of type 1 radial head fractures should be joint aspiration, followed by immobilisation in a broad arm sling for 2 days. At the first outpatient visit, assessment of the collateral stability should be performed. Patients with stable elbows should be encouraged to stretch these beyond the painful range. Patients can be discharged at this stage with an advice to come back for a clinical and radiographic assessment if there is no improvement at 6 weeks.

PURPOSE: The use of percutaneous iliosacral screw fixation as a treatment of sacroiliac joint pain has been reported to be successful. This study was a prospective single surgeon series to evaluate the short-term outcomes of patients who underwent percutaneous sacroiliac joint stabilisation. METHODS: Between July 2004 and February 2011, 73 patients underwent percutaneous sacroiliac joint fusion in our unit. All patients completed a short form (SF)-36 questionnaire, visual analogue pain score and Majeed scoring questionnaire prior to treatment and at last follow-up. RESULTS: 55 patients (9 male and 46 female) completed follow-up. The average follow-up period was for 36.18 months (range 12-84). The mean preoperative SF-36 scores were 26.59 for physical health and 40.38 for mental health. The mean postoperative SF-36 scores were 42.93 for physical health and 52.77 for mental health. The mean visual analogue pain scores were 8.1 preoperative and 4.5 postoperative. The mean pelvic specific scoring were 36.9 preoperative and 64.78 postoperative. We noted that patients who had previous instrumented spinal surgery did significantly worse than those who had not. We had two nerve root-related complications. CONCLUSION: We conclude that in selected patient group who respond positively to CT-guided injection, a percutaneous SI joint stabilisation is beneficial in effecting pain relief and functional improvement.

AIM: The cost of treating trauma and musculoskeletal conditions per head of population in Wales in 2007-2010 increased from £183 to £236, representing an increase in National Health Service total expenditure of 13.11 %. This study was set up to determine whether the public is aware of the general costs of treatment within the trauma and orthopaedic department. METHOD: Patients completed a questionnaire asking them what they thought the cost was for common orthopaedic treatments, investigations and implants. This questionnaire was completed whilst they were waiting to be seen in clinic. RESULTS: We had 183 completed questionnaires from patients with an average age of 43.47 years (range, 18-85 years). All patients were members of the public, with no previous experience of NHS work or costing. The inter-rater reliability was 0.39(95 % CI, 0.178-0.559). A product was accurately assessed if the estimates were between 50 and 200 % of the true cost. Costs of arm slings and crutches were well estimated by >80 % of the respondents. Approximately 60 % accurately estimated the cost of a fracture clinic visit, hospital transport and physiotherapy and lower limb plaster. Only 22.5 % accurately estimated the cost of a knee X-ray with 37.6 % overestimating the cost by more than tenfold. Other expenses that were underestimated by patients were the costs of a total hip replacement (in 58.3 %), fixation of an ankle fracture (in 32.2 %) and an overnight inpatient stay (in 10.9 %). CONCLUSION: Whilst the costs of physical products were well estimated by our cohort of patients, the costs of less tangible products, such as radiology and operations, were poorly estimated. Our study shows that there is a poor public perception of the true cost for investigation and operative treatment of common trauma and orthopaedic conditions.

Based on success of hip resurfacing, large head Metal on Metal (MoM) hip arthroplasty has gained significant popularity in recent years. There are growing concerns about metal ions related soft tissue abnormalities. The aim of this study was to define a correlation of metal ions with various functional outcome scores following large head MoM hip arthroplasty. Consecutive cohort of 70 patients (76 hips) with large head MoM hip arthroplasty using SL-Plus femoral stem and Cormet acetabular component were prospectively followed up. An independent observer assessed the patients which included serology for metal ion levels and collection of Oxford Hip, Harris hip, WOMAC, SF-36 & modified UCLA scores. Median serum cobalt and chromium levels were 3.10 µg/L (0.35-62.92) and 4.21 µg/L (0.73-69.27) with total of median 7.30 µg/L (2.38-132.19). The median Oxford, Harris, WOMAC, SF-36 and modified UCLA scores were 36 (6-48), 87 (21-100), 36 (24-110), 104 (10-125), and 3 (1-9), respectively. Seventeen patients had elevated serum cobalt and chromium levels ≥7 µg/L. There was no significant correlation between serum metal ion levels with any of these outcome scores. We recommend extreme caution during follow up of these patients with large head MoM arthroplasty.

OBJECTIVE: The aim of the study was to assess the inter-observer reliability and intraobserver reproducibility of three different classification systems for tibial plateau fractures. MATERIALS AND METHODS: Four observers of various levels of experience classified 50 tibial plateau fractures. The same observers repeated the classification of the same fractures after an interval of 8 weeks. Inter- and intra-observer variability was assessed using the mean kappa co-efficient and the mean percentage of agreement. RESULTS: For inter-observer reliability, the mean kappa co-efficient values for Arbeitsgemeinschaft für Osteosynthesefragen (AO), Schatzker and Hohl and Moore classifications were 0.36, 0.47 and 0.14, respectively. The mean percentage of agreement was 0.52, 0.59 and 0.34, respectively. For intra-observer reliability kappa-values were 0.80, 0.91 and 0.76 and the mean percentage of agreement was 0.88, 0.93 and 0.85 in the same order. CONCLUSIONS: Our results show that none of the classification systems were ideal. The Schatzker classification system was superior to the AO and the Hohl and Moore systems both in terms of inter-observer reliability and intra-observer reproducibility. However, there is a need for developing a more comprehensive approach to judge the classification systems.
